Admission Requirements

Academic Requirements

Graduates from the programs anticipate serving as global academics; researchers; leaders of business, industry, government, and non-governmental organizations; among others.

Applicants with non-business undergraduate degrees are required to complete the Post-Graduate Diploma in Management (PGDM), which upon completion will prepare them to pursue the regular MBA program.

Candidates seeking admission into this program MUST possess first degrees in business related disciplines (with not less than 2nd class honors) from recognized universities.
